Introduction

Silver Pepper Castor

A silver pepper castor is a tabletop vessel designed for shaking or casting ground seasoning over food. These items appear across several periods, notably the Georgian, Victorian, and Edwardian eras, as well as the early twentieth century.

The selection on this page includes standard pepper pots alongside sugar shakers, larger condiment castors, novelty animal designs such as dogs and owls, vehicle forms including cars and carriages, and multi-bottle cruet sets.

Materials span sterling silver, silver plate, 800 silver, pewter, and cut glass components, reflecting diverse manufacturing standards from different decades and workshops.

How they were made

Materials and construction methods

Silversmiths formed the bodies of these vessels using solid sterling silver, 800 silver, or silver plate applied to a base metal, frequently pairing metalwork with cut glass elements in cruet frames.

Lids were pierced with decorative patterns to allow seasoning to shake through evenly, often secured with threaded collars or push-fit rims designed for easy refilling.

What sets them apart

Assessing quality in silver castors

Quality separates through the weight of the metal used and the crispness of the pierced work on the cap. Thicker gauge silver and well-defined detailing denote finer production standards.

The intricacy of design, particularly in novelty pieces shaped as animals or vehicles, distinguishes standard tableware from exceptional examples.

Terms antiques dealers use

The Silver Pepper Castor Glossary

Castor
A small container with a pierced top used for shaking dry condiments like sugar or pepper onto food. They appear in various sizes from single table pots to large monumental examples.
Cruet set
A matched group of condiment bottles or pots held together in a frame or stand for the dining table. These often include combinations for oil, vinegar, mustard, and pepper.
Sterling silver
An alloy containing a high proportion of pure silver combined with other metals to increase durability. Items made to this standard frequently carry official hallmarks.
Silver plate
A manufacturing method where a thin layer of silver is bonded to a base metal such as copper or Britannia metal. This provided a bright finish at a lower cost than solid silver.
Questions people ask

Silver Pepper Castor: Frequently Asked Questions

What is a silver pepper castor?

A silver pepper castor is a small tabletop vessel featuring a pierced lid designed for shaking ground pepper onto food during meals.

These pieces range from simple utilitarian pots to ornate novelty shapes and monumental Georgian designs.

How were silver castors used?

They were placed on dining tables alongside other condiments so diners could season their dishes to taste.

Many examples formed part of larger cruet sets that held multiple bottles and pots in a shared frame.

Are these castors made of solid silver?

The listings include both solid sterling silver and 800 silver alongside silver plated items over base metals.

Individual pieces also incorporate cut glass bodies paired with silver pierced caps and mounts.
